For the second winter in a row, parts of East Anglia, central and south-eastern England have seen worryingly little rain.
Today ministers, water companies and environment groups have been meeting at Westminster to examine the options.
An inquest has heard how a Derby woman who struggled with her obesity for years died just days after weight loss surgery.
Claire White from Sinfin had a gastric band fitted at the Royal Derby Hospital. But the 37-year-old had an infection after the operation and died because of a blood clot.
